Here are the outlines of a few seminars that I have given to property management companies and groups. There are some good topics that you can use as a jumping off point for a sales meeting, even if I am not there to help you.

“Sales 101”….How basic selling skills can boost rental activity at your property.

-Designing greetings that create the right mood.**-Asking discovery questions that lead the sales process in the right direction and help the prospect sell him or her self. -Building agreement on the issues that effect the sale. -Creating urgency to do business now. -Closing the deal. Making sure to always ask for the business. -Structuring your sales presentations to be short, sweet and effective. “Creating a Selling Culture”…Transform your business into a selling organization. -What is the “Culture” of your organization? -What is a “Selling Culture”? -How does a “Selling Culture” work in self-storage? -Words and deeds that create a “Selling Culture”. -Compensation schemes, motivations and performance goals and their effect on your company’s culture. “Selecting and Training Sales Oriented Personnel”…How to get the right people on board and give them the tools and skills required to out-sell your competitors. -Who is the ideal candidate? -Where do you find the ideal candidate? -How do candidates weed themselves out? -Simple qualifiers that tell you if you can quickly reject a candidate. -Interviewing, pre-testing and re-testing. -The cycle of new employees: The first few days. The first few weeks. The first few months. How these thresholds can be used to encourage and motivate the “good” ones and weed out the others. Thanks, Tron
